As for the question whether to use I look forward to or I am looking forward to some people consider the two completely interchangeable but most find the phrase with look forward to somewhat formal and best suited for formal correspondence whereas to be looking forward to is more informal and friendly.

I am looking forward to is less formal and more likely to be the phrase of choice when speaking or writing to a friend.
